#592568 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#592568 is composed of 34.9% red, 14.5%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.4% cyan, 64.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 286.6 degrees, a saturation of 47.5% and a lightness of 27.6%. #592568 color hex could be obtained by blending #b24ad0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

#592568 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#592568 has RGB values of R:89, G:37,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.14, M:0.64, Y:0, K:0.59. Its decimal value is 5842280.

Shades and Tints of #592568
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020103 is the darkest color, while #f9f3f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#592568
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#474647 is the less saturated color, while #6b0489 is the most saturated one.
